Ingredients for Tropical Mango Salsa

Mangos bring the sweet, juicy base to this salsa. Make sure they're ripe but still firm for the best texture. The red bell pepper adds a satisfying crunch and a pop of color. Red onion provides a sharp, savory contrast to the sweet mango, while jalapeño introduces a gentle heat that can be adjusted to your liking. Fresh cilantro brings a burst of herby freshness, and the lime juice ties everything together with its tangy brightness. A touch of salt and black pepper enhances all these flavors perfectly.

Tips & Tricks

  • Choose mangos that yield slightly to pressure but aren't mushy.
  • To tame the heat, remove the seeds and ribs from the jalapeño.
  • For a sweeter salsa, add a teaspoon of honey or a splash of orange juice.
  • If you’re not a fan of cilantro, parsley can be a good alternative.

Serving Suggestions

This mango salsa pairs beautifully with grilled fish or chicken, adding a bright contrast to the smoky flavors. It's also fantastic as a topping for tacos or as a dip with tortilla chips. For a light lunch, try it over a bed of greens with some avocado.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make this salsa ahead of time?
Yes, it actually tastes better after sitting in the fridge for a few hours.
How long will the salsa keep?
St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ator, it will keep for 2-3 days.
What if I can't find ripe mangos?
You can substitute with peaches or pineapples for a different twist.

Tropical Mango Salsa Recipe Walkthrough

Start by grabbing a large bowl and adding in your diced mango. Make sure the pieces are bite-sized — nobody wants to wrestle with giant chunks of fruit! Next, toss in the finely chopped red bell pepper and red onion. These should be cut small enough to blend seamlessly with the mango.

Add the minced jalapeño and chopped cilantro to your bowl. If you're worried about the heat, start with half the jalapeño and add more if desired. Now, squeeze the juice of one lime over the mixture. This step is crucial, as the lime juice not only enhances the flavors but also helps to meld them together.

Sprinkle in the salt and black pepper. Remember, you can always add more, but you can't take it out, so start with a little and adjust according to taste. Gently toss all the ingredients until everything is well combined and coated in that lovely lime juice.

At this point, taste your salsa and adjust any seasonings if needed. You can serve it right away, or for an even better flavor experience, cover and let it sit in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to develop.

Ingredients

2 ripe mangos, diced
1/2 cup red bell pepper, finely chopped
1/4 cup red onion, finely chopped
1 jalapeño, seeded and minced
1/4 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
1 lime, juiced
1/2 tsp salt
1/4 tsp black pepper

Step-by-step Instructions

1. In a large bowl, combine diced mango, red bell pepper, and red onion.
2. Add the minced jalapeño and chopped cilantro to the bowl.
3. Squeeze lime juice over the mixture and season with salt and black pepper.
4. Gently toss the ingredients until well mixed.
5.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ary.
6. Serve immediately or ref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to let the flavors meld.
